Royal Blind Society of NSW White Cane Day Kevin Stapleton Wally Urgacz Margaret Rihr Mobility - historical 5 x B/W photographs of men using a white cane Kevin Stapleton and Wally Urgacz using their white canes Photograph Image ...RBS client Kevin Stapleton uses a white cane as he descends church steps, crosses a road and walks along the footpath. Another RBS client, Wally Urgacz, walks behind Kevin as he crosses the road in the Sydney CBD.
